Omega Speedmaster*** 105.003-63*** 1964
OMEGA Speedmaster Straight Lug Ref. 105.003-65 "Ed White", Circa 1964
Serial: 20525024
Circa: 1964
Reference No.: 105.003-63

CASE: 39mm, stainless steel, black ‘DO90’ tachymeter bezel, straight lugs

DIAL: Black dial with applied Omega logo, tritium hour markers & T SWISS MADE T printed at the bottom

MOVEMENT: Calibre 321, hand-wound column wheel chronograph, 17 jewels

BRACELET: Omega Stainless Steel 7912/6 Bracelet, dated 2.64

CONDITION REPORT: The dial, hands, bezel and case are all original. The case is excellent condition and overall sharp and thick. The rare 7912/6 bracelet is in mint condition complete with full links. Overall a stunning example of the first reference 105.003-63.

NOTES: The present watch was manufactured on November 30, 1964 and subsequently delivered to France according to the Omega Museum.

The 105.003 reference is nicknamed 'Ed White' after the astronaut who famously wore this reference into space in 1965. The straight lug case was discontinued in 1967-68 at the end of the production of the 321 caliber and are not only rare, but highly collectible.
